Diagnostic solutions GI Map

This is one of the most in-depth stool sample tests that is currently on the market.
This test will analyze any parasitic, viral, yeast, fungi, or bacterial infections within the body.
It also provides us with information regarding your good gut-bacteria balance, digestion ability, immune responses, gut inflammation, and any microbiotic resistance genes.

GI Map Panel Tests for:

 

  • Parasites

  • Viruses

  • Bacteria (Infections + Balance) 

  • Digestive Enzymes

  • Immune Responses

  • Intestinal Inflammation

  • Intestinal Immune Response

  • Potential Autoimmune Triggers

  • Antibiotic-Resistance Genes
